Inside Scope
Most people try to help when a friend or family member is sick or injured, but it may feel complicated when the illness is addiction. In this episode of Inside Scope, host Dr. Daniel Haight talks with addiction specialist Dr. Lindsey Hastings-Spaine about how to broach this topic when someone is suffering. Addiction is one of the most common preventable diseases in the U.S., says Dr. Hastings-Spaine, and in some cases, addiction may be related to someone “self-medicating” to cope with another illness. If you’re concerned about someone, she says you should let them know you care but carefully avoid being judgmental.
